I think we are missing the boat on Jicama (Hee-Ka-Mah) here in the US. It is sweet, crunchy, full of fiber, vitamin C and low in calorie. Here is a favorite side dish featuring the humble jicama!
Ingredients:
- 1 cup peeled, julienned jicama
- 1 cup julienned carrots
- 1 cup peeled, julienned apples
- 1 tablespoon of fresh. chopped cilantro
- 3 Tablespoon of fresh juiced lime
- 1 Tablespoon of rice wine vinegar
- 3/4 cup extra virgin olive oil
- Salt & pepper to taste
Instructions:
Mix the vinaigrette by combining the lime juice, rice wine vinegar and olive oil. Set aside
Place julienned jicama, apples and carrots in a large bowl
Whisk the vinaigrette to incorporate and toss with fruit/vegetable mix.
Salt and pepper to taste
For best flavor, rest in the refrigerator 30 minutes or more
Time: 15 minutes plus resting time
Yields: 4 servings
